an ultra high performance liquid chromatography-quadrupole-orbitrap mass spectrometry was developed for non directional screening of mycotoxins in dairy products.Under the mass spectrometry data dependent scanning mode
the molecular ion mass to charge ratios
secondary fragmented fragments mass to charge ratios and retention times of 38 typical mycotoxins reference materials were collected.A standard database for mycotoxins was established
and the analysis on fragmentation path was completed.The characteristic fragment fragments were combined with the standard database for mycotoxins in a mass spectrum independent scanning mode to finally achieve a non-directional screening of mycotoxins in dairy products.The detection limit(CCα) and the detection capacity(CCβ) of this method were in the ranges of 0.01-0.36 μg/kg and 0.03-0.57 μg/kg
respectively.and the recoveries ranged from 81.9% to 111% with relative standard deviations of 1.1%-6.1%.The established method was used to screen 40 batches of pasteurized milk
ultra high temperature instant sterilized milk
milk containing beverages and infant formula milk powder.Results showed that the method was simple and rapid
and could meet the requirements for accurate determination and quantitation of mycotoxins in dairy products.
